Table of ContentsChapter 1: Oracle 12c R2 New Features and Tuning Overview Chapter 2: Basic Index Principles (Beginner Developer and Beginner DBA) Chapter 3: Finding Disk I/O Bottlenecks Chapter 4: Initialization Parameters and Tuning Chapter 5: Oracle Enterprise Manager Chapter 6: Using Explain Plan and Tkprof Chapter 7: Basic Hint Syntax (Developer and DBA) Chapter 8: Query Tuning: Developer and Beginner DBA Chapter 9: Table Joins & Other Advanced Tuning (Advanced DBA and Developer) Chapter 10: Using PL/SQL to Enhance Performance Chapter 11: Oracle Cloud, Exadata, Exalogic, Tuning RAC & Parallel Features Chapter 12: V$ Views and Tuning (Developer and DBA) Chapter 13: X$ Tables and Tuning Chapter 14: Using AWR & Statspacl to Tune Waits and Latches Chapter 15: Performing a Quick System Review (DBA) Chapter 16: Monitoring the System Using UNIX Utilities (DBA) Appendix A: Key Initialization Parameters (DBA) Appendix B: The V$ Views (DBA and Developer) Appendix C: The X$ Tables (DBA)ReviewsAuthor InformationMcGraw-Hill authors represent the leading experts in their fields and are dedicated to improving the lives, careers, and interests of readers worldwide Tab Content 6Author Website:Countries AvailableAll regions |
